Location Overview
Join our team in Amangiri. Blending into untouched red-rock country on over 900 acres of the Colorado Plateau, Amangiri and its satellite, Camp Sarika, reflect dual aspects of this ancient desert landscape. A serene sanctuary, Amangiri's 34 modernist suites, Aman Spa and mesa-embracing pool echo the tranquillity of the canyons. Camp Sarika, with its 10 tented pavilions, answers the region's call to adventure. An unrivalled base for exhilarating expeditions and fireside connection, the camp has its own restaurant, lounge and spa suites.
This is a remote position based in Miami, Florida, supporting Amangiri in Canyon Point, Utah. The role requires regular travel to represent the resort at industry events, partner meetings, and familiarization experiences.
Role
The Leisure Sales Manager is responsible for driving revenue growth within the leisure segment through strategic sales initiatives, targeted business development, and relationship management with key luxury travel partners. Reporting to the Director of Sales & Marketing, this role represents the resort within the global luxury travel community and cultivates partnerships with travel advisors, consortia, and wholesale partners to position the resort as a preferred destination.
Responsibilities
Develop and execute a comprehensive leisure sales strategy aligned with the resort's annual revenue goals.
Identify high-value leisure accounts and opportunities to expand market share.
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with luxury travel advisors, consortia partners, and wholesale accounts.
Conduct sales calls, virtual trainings, webinars, and site inspections to strengthen partner engagement.
Proactively prospect new business opportunities and emerging leisure markets.
Represent the resort at trade shows, roadshows, and industry events.
Coordinate and host familiarization trips (FAM trips) for key partners.
Maintain accurate account profiles, production reports, and sales activity records.
Monitor account performance and develop strategies to exceed sales targets.
Collaborate with marketing, reservations, and operations teams to align sales initiatives with guest experience delivery.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Business, Hospitality, Marketing, or related field preferred.
Minimum 3-5 years of luxury hotel or resort sales experience, preferably within the leisure segment.
Established relationships with luxury travel advisors and consortia partners preferred.
Strong negotiation, networking, and relationship-building skills.
Knowledge of GDS, online distribution platforms, and leisure travel market trends.
Experience with CRM systems such as Salesforce or Delphi preferred.
Proficiency in PMS systems and Microsoft Office Suite.
Exceptional commun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
Ability to travel domestically and internationally as business needs require.
Legal authorization to work in the United States.
